You don’t see people comparing a Bavarian Mountain Scent Hound and a Portuguese Pointer every day, but when you do, it’s usually an active family or seasoned hunter weighing which high-drive, nose-led dog fits their life. Both are rare, both are driven, and both come with that intense focus that says, “I was built for a job.” But that’s where the similarities end. The Bavarian Mountain Hound is a quiet, deliberate tracker, bred to follow cold blood trails through rugged alpine terrain. He’s reserved with strangers, steady in temperament, and happiest when working a scent line in deep woods or open hills. He bonds fiercely with his handler, but he’s not the kind of dog who’ll wag his way into every guest’s lap. He needs space, structure, and consistent training. Let him off leash without ironclad recall? Don’t bother calling him back. The Portuguese Pointer, on the other hand, is pure enthusiasm tied to a leash. Smarter, more adaptable, and wildly affectionate, he thrives in a family setting. He’s the one who’ll retrieve the kids’ balls for hours, then pivot to bird work with laser focus. He’s louder in drive but softer in temperament, eager to please, and surprisingly at home in a rural yard as long as he gets serious daily exercise. Here’s the real difference: the Bavarian is a specialist. He’s happiest when tracking, and that singular focus means he’s harder to redirect. The Portuguese Pointer is a sporting athlete. he wants to do everything with you, whether it’s hunting, hiking, or playing fetch. If you’re a hunter who lives in the mountains and values precision, go Bavarian. If you want a versatile, family-friendly gun dog with endless stamina and heart, the Portuguese Pointer will steal yours.
